Insurance premiums are likely to rise in the areas affected by the recent storms, homeowners have been warned.

The price comparison website said those assessing damage to their homes and gardens this morning could be hit with a sharp rise in the cost of their premium when they come to renew it.

"The full impact on home and car insurance premiums is not yet fully known," said Ashton Berkhauer, insurance expert at uSwitch.com.

"However, analysis by uSwitch.com indicates that home owners in the south-west affected by the storm damage who go on to make a claim, could take a second hit with home insurance premium increases of up to 40 per cent when they come to renew their policy."

Insurers are still reeling from the £3 billion bill for last summer's floods, which were among the worst in living memory.

The storms over the last 24 hours are set to further dent the balance sheets of leading firms, making some premium increases inevitable.
